Output 087bbd702356a554e767d9cd751d3b669e55899c2d759d3880e80e27c5ebc1f7:1

value
1968845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87004fbc8ea7ab7c11e151c6f41e428a245970cf OP_EQUAL
address
3DzqX5iuM7U2TSv8iPVLHsNodZwmqAwqiS
transaction
087bbd702356a554e767d9cd751d3b669e55899c2d759d3880e80e27c5ebc1f7
confirmations
268590
spent
true